Counted locally with the o200k_base tokenizer, which is exact for GPT models; Claude uses its own tokenizer and its counts differ. Treat this as one consistent yardstick across the catalogue rather than a bill. Prices are per million input tokens.
| Model | Per session | Once invoked |
|---|---|---|
| Fable 5.1 | $0.00039 | $0.01109 |
| Opus 5 | $0.00019 | $0.00554 |
| Sonnet 5 | $0.00008 | $0.00222 |
| Haiku 4.5 | $0.00004 | $0.00111 |

Objective
You are executing the CocoBloom crystallization pathway. Your task is to extract a reusable skill from a recently completed and shipped execution trace.
Before proceeding, verify that .cocoplus/ exists. If not, output: "CocoPlus is not initialized. Run $pod init first." Then stop.
Step 1 — Verify Recent Successful Ship
Read .cocoplus/lifecycle/meta.json. Check that:
current_phaseis"ship"andship_completed_atexists, OR- The most recent phase entry shows a successful ship within the last 7 days
If no recent successful $ship found, output: "CocoBloom crystallization requires a recent successful $ship. Complete the lifecycle through the Ship phase before crystallizing." Then stop.
Step 2 — Read Execution Trace
Read .cocoplus/lifecycle/deployment.md and the most recent flow stage outputs from .cocoplus/flow.json runtime state. Collect:
- What was built (deliverables)
- Which patterns were applied
- Key decisions made
- Commands and sequences that worked well
- Any non-obvious techniques used
Step 3 — Spawn Trace Reader (Haiku)
Pass the execution trace to a Haiku sub-agent with this mandate:
"Read the execution trace and identify the most reusable pattern. A reusable pattern is:
- A sequence of steps that would apply to similar future tasks
- Not specific to this project's data (generalizable with parameters)
- Meaningful enough that having it as a skill would save 10+ minutes of re-derivation
Output:
- Pattern name (kebab-case, ≤5 words)
- What problem it solves (1 sentence)
- The generalized step sequence (numbered)
- Parameters that would need to be filled in for a new project
- What makes it non-obvious (why is this worth preserving?)
If no generalizable pattern exists, output: NO_CRYSTALLIZABLE_PATTERN"
If the sub-agent outputs NO_CRYSTALLIZABLE_PATTERN, tell the developer: "No generalizable pattern found in this execution trace. Crystallization requires a pattern that would apply to future projects." Then stop.
